AIM(TM) "ST" Module for DeviceNet(TM) and PROFIBUS®-DP Networks


Minneapolis, MN-December 13, 2002-InterlinkBT(TM) has announced their new busstop® station, which is designed for direct mounting on motor control enclosures. The module provides I/O, power and network signals to both inside and outside the enclosure.

The AIM "ST" Module includes up to eight dry contactor inputs and eight contactor outputs. These signals are accessed via the removable screw terminals on the back of the station. Outside the enclosure, signals are accessed via industry standard 5-Pin eurofast® or 4-Pin and 5-Pin minifast® connectors.

If an I/O point is not needed inside the enclosure, it can be connected to three-wire PNP sensors and actuators via the eight eurofast® ports on the front of the module. This unprecedented flexibility allows users to have a total of eight inputs and eight outputs, some inside and some outside the enclosure. In addition, the rear screw terminals provide a clean way to get power and DeviceNet(TM) signals inside the enclosure.

LED's on the front of the module provide signal status of the inputs/outputs, and station status. The address of the station is set via two rotary switches located under a protective cover. The station is epoxy-encapsulated and equipped throughout with metal connectors. Rated NEMA 1, 3, 4, 12, 13 and IEC IP67, this rugged station allows installation in the harshest environments and is ideal anywhere small enclosure I/O counts are needed.
